基因型和环境对小麦籽粒戊聚糖含量和黏度的影响  被引量:7

Effects of Genotypes and Environments on Pentosan Content and Viscosity in Wheat Grains

摘  要:选取6个小麦品种和5种生态环境,测定了小麦籽粒中总戊聚糖含量、水溶性戊聚糖含量和籽粒提取液黏度,探讨了这3个性状的影响因素和相互关系。结果表明,籽粒总戊聚糖含量、水溶性戊聚糖含量和黏度均受到基因型、环境以及二者互作的影响。其中,基因型是戊聚糖含量的重要影响因素,环境与基因型互作是籽粒提取液黏度的重要影响因素。水溶性戊聚糖含量与籽粒提取液黏度呈极显著正相关。The contents of total pentosan (TP),water-soluble pentosan (WSP) and the viscosity in the grains of 6 wheat genotypes planted in 5 environments were determined to investigate their correlation and the effects of genotypes and environments. The results showed that these three characters were all impacted obviously by genotypes, environments and their interaction. Genotypes were the key factor on the pentosan content, while the interaction on the viscosity. There was significantly positive correlation between WSP content and viscosity.
